FAQs for booking Abuja to London flights

  • Will I be able to exchange naira for sterling at Abuja Airport?

    There are a few foreign exchange offices at Abuja International Airport. You will be able to prepare for your arrival in London by exchanging naira for sterling beforehand. When you arrive at Heathrow, there will be a wider selection of foreign exchange offices.

  • I have a service dog that needs to travel with me. Which airline will accommodate us?

    All airlines do accommodate service animals with the appropriate documentation and conditions. These are usually updated vaccination records, hygiene records and training papers stating the validity of the animal’s service. Air France is an airline that will allow the animal to fly without a muzzle, whereas some other airlines will insist on muzzling.

  • I am flying alone with a baby on Lufthansa. Can I get additional assistance?

    Babies are well accommodated on Lufthansa Airlines. They encourage night flights for babies, to maintain sleep patterns, and have changing tables on board as well as baby food available, should you run out. You can also get spare nappies and a bassinet for them to sleep in during the flight. There is a voluntary use of child seat restraints for children under seven that you are welcome to use for toddlers.

  • When I arrive at Heathrow Airport, will I be able to find a prayer room?

    As Nigeria has one of the biggest Muslim populations in Africa, passengers flying from Abuja to Heathrow will no doubt find the seven prayer rooms across Terminals 2, 3, 4 and 5 very comforting. All in all, six major world faiths are represented at Heathrow’s prayer facilities.

KAYAK’s top tips for finding a cheap flight from Abuja to London Heathrow Airport

  • Looking for a cheap flight? 25% of our users found flights on this route for $699 or less one-way and $920 or less round-trip.
  • When flying from Abuja, Nigeria, to London Heathrow Airport (LHR), you will be departing from Nnamdi Azikiwe International Airport (ABV), also known as Abuja Airport. It is based 23 miles from central Abuja. You can take the Ajuba Rail Mass Transit’s Yellow Line from Abuja Metro Station and find yourself at the airport in about 40min. Alternatively, it is faster by road if you take a taxi.
  • Book in advance to relax in SDS Executive Lounge at Abuja Airport (ABV) before your flight. Find comfy seats, food, drinks and unlimited Wi-Fi as well as other perks. At the international terminals, you can also find FAAN Lounge and Gabfol Lounge. They are great if you are working during your trip or just want to prepare for the flight ahead.
  • It is advisable when you are flying with a layover to wrap bags for extra safety. It will prevent interference and pilferage. Like most airports, you will be able to find wrapping stations at the Departure terminals of Abuja Airport.
  • You can choose from several major airlines to take you on your Abuja to London Heathrow trip, including Lufthansa, Air France and British Airways. The layovers with Lufthansa are usually in Frankfurt, while with Air France they are mostly in Paris. British Airways offers direct flights with no layovers. Layovers on this flight are relatively short, averaging between 1h 30min and 2h 30min.
